Bonifacio Global City is a perfect place for me. It is my hangout whenever I am in Metro Manila. The 100% pure beef goodness of Brother’s Burger is tried and tested already. Oftentimes I also get my travel maps at the Fully Booked in Bonifacio High Street.

See the photo of the fountain below? It’s in Market! Market! I really love that water fountain so much. I love to see kids play there especially during weekends. Indeed it is a great place for family bonding.

Another reason why I like Market! Market is the booths allocated for cities and provinces where they can sell local produce.

I really thankful Sler’s Porkloin Ham, one of my personal favorite, is readily available at the Cagyan de Oro booth, and Vjandepp’s flavorful Pastel from the Camiguin Booth in Market! Market!

An afternoon at the B’laan Village in Lamlifew

During my first day in General Santos City, I decided to travel to the town of Malungon in the province of Sarangani. Malungon is only 45 minutes away from General Santos via comfortable bus ride.
